I, like many of my readers, gravitate to classic styles that I know I can wear with confidence for years. But if we wear too many classics in one outfit without keeping silhouettes and details modern, we can begin to look a little dated, even frumpy. So I have a few brands that I lean into to help me keep my wardrobe more current. Evereve, a brand founded by Megan and Mike Tamte who are now in their 50s, aims to “move women forward in their fashion and in their lives so they feel fully alive.” Yes, this brand’s goal is actually to help us keep our wardrobes up to date and fabulous. It’s smart to have a few stores that you are familiar with but that also push you a little out of your comfort zone. Otherwise your style can become a little stale and you can begin to feel stuck. Most of us have retailers we’ve enjoyed shopping for years, and that’s great. But do you also have stores or websites where you can visit for the latest trends in jean silhouettes, accessories, necklines, fits and footwear?

Evereve regularly curates their collections from 150+ brands, so you have a wide variety of styles and price points to choose from. But you’ll also discover that many of their selections will give your outfits a bit of edge, a fashion forward feel and, yes, some youthful vitality. And you’ll find garments and accessories that fit your real lifestyle, whether that includes workwear, travel capsules, athleisurewear for home and out and about or elevated streetwear.

I’ve been shopping Evereve for about seven years now, and I’ve become very comfortable navigating this modern classic store. But if you’re new to it, pace yourself. Edgier, more modern styles can feel a little jarring at first if you are used to a more conservative style. For instance, if you’ve mostly shopped Talbots, Chico’s and J.Jill, the Evereve offerings may feel too young for you. Trust me, they’re not. While you’ll certainly see some items that don’t suit your taste, you do not age out of styles. Your tastes may change, and that’s perfectly okay. Not everything at any given store should suit anyone. So don’t mark Evereve off as too young. Instead, browse it with an eye for what’s modern, a little fashion forward. Recently as we put away our Christmas decorations I noticed how much stuff we have in storage in our basement. Honestly, my husband has a harder time letting go of things than I do. In fact, sometimes I am a bit too hasty in ridding ourselves of items we’ve accumulated over the years. I think for James the camping equipment, outdated kitchen gadgets and sporting goods that line the shelves in our storage area are more valuable for the memories they hold rather than the benefit they provide. 

Eventually we’ll rid ourselves of these items – hopefully sooner than later. But they’re not doing us any real harm right now, tucked down in our basement. That said, the day could come when one or both of us struggles to move them out due to health problems. Accumulated stuff eventually becomes a deficit and a burden. On the other hand, when we accumulate treasures in heaven – by sharing the gospel, serving others and giving God’s grace to those who need it – we can know that we’re investing in that will never lose its value. Where are you storing up your treasure?

“Do not store up for yourselves treasures on earth, where moth and rust destroy, and where thieves break in and steal. But store up for yourselves treasures in heaven, where neither moth nor rust destroys, and where thieves do not break in or steal; for where your treasure is, there your heart will be also.” ~ Matthew 6:19-21
